release(openrouter): 0.2.1 (#36348)

This commit is contained in:
Mason Daugherty
2026-03-29 20:50:14 -04:00
committed by GitHub
parent 64bbcef37e
commit 342d8bdef2
4 changed files with 85 additions and 85 deletions

View File

@@ -2507,8 +2507,8 @@ class TestWrapMessagesForSdk:
]
result = _wrap_messages_for_sdk(msgs)
assert len(result) == 2
assert isinstance(result[0], components.SystemMessage)
assert isinstance(result[1], components.UserMessage)
assert isinstance(result[0], components.ChatSystemMessage)
assert isinstance(result[1], components.ChatUserMessage)
def test_wrapped_serializes_correctly(self) -> None:
"""Wrapped models should serialize to the correct JSON payload."""
@@ -2565,10 +2565,10 @@ class TestWrapMessagesForSdk:
{"role": "tool", "content": "result", "tool_call_id": "c1"},
]
result = _wrap_messages_for_sdk(msgs)
assert isinstance(result[0], components.SystemMessage)
assert isinstance(result[1], components.UserMessage)
assert isinstance(result[2], components.AssistantMessage)
assert isinstance(result[3], components.ToolResponseMessage)
assert isinstance(result[0], components.ChatSystemMessage)
assert isinstance(result[1], components.ChatUserMessage)
assert isinstance(result[2], components.ChatAssistantMessage)
assert isinstance(result[3], components.ChatToolMessage)
# ===========================================================================